One cup of Bacon wrapped brussels sprout is around 100 grams and contains approximately 65 calories, 4 grams of protein, 4 grams of fat, and 3 grams of carbohydrates.
Bacon Wrapped Brussels Sprout is a mouthwatering appetizer that combines the earthy flavors of roasted Brussels sprouts with the savory richness of crispy bacon. Originating from modern American cuisine, this dish elevates a simple vegetable into a crowd-pleaser. Each sprout is perfectly wrapped in smoky bacon, creating a delightful contrast of textures. While Brussels sprouts are packed with vitamins and fiber, adding bacon introduces a bit of indulgence.
